What a Fetid Flower!

fetid-cool-word-fun-way-to-learn-new-wordsHave you ever stopped to smell the fresh scent of flowers in a summer garden?

If so, you probably expect a naturally pleasant aroma. But don’t be fooled into thinking that all flowers are sweet smelling. A group of flowers known as carrion flowers may look beautiful but actually produce a foul smell.

These fetid (see definition and hear pronunciation below) flowers are also known as “corpse flowers” or “stinking flowers.”

So, the next time you smell the fresh scent of a flower garden be thankful that you aren’t smelling a carrion flower!

Fetid: Having an offensive smell, stinking.
